JHMM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2018 in Review
60 of the 4,488 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in John Hancock Multifactor Mid Cap ETF (JHMM) for Q4 2018, worth a combined $539M — up 46% from $370M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 16 funds opened new JHMM positions and 8 closed out — a net gain of 8 holders — while 27 added to existing stakes and 14 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Manulife (Manufacturers Life Insurance), adding an estimated $216M. The largest seller was Cerity Partners OCIO, cutting an estimated $27.8M.
